Product Introduction

Overview

The LMX1602TMX/NOPB is an integrated dual frequency synthesizer produced by Texas Instruments. This component is designed to be used in local oscillator subsystems for radio applications, offering low current consumption and high performance. Although it is currently obsolete and no longer manufactured, it remains relevant for existing designs and legacy systems.

Product Attributes

Type:PLL Frequency Synthesizer, Delta Sigma
PLL:Yes with Bypass
Input:CMOS, TTL
Output:CMOS
Number of Circuits:1
Ratio - Input:Output:3:1
Differential - Input:Output:No/No
Frequency - Max:1.1GHz
Divider/Multiplier:Yes/No
Voltage - Supply:2.7V ~ 3.6V
Operating Temperature:-40°C ~ 85°C
Mounting Type:Surface Mount
Package / Case:16-TSSOP (0.173", 4.40mm Width)
Supplier Device Package:16-TSSOP
